Mud daubers are available black and yellow like yellowjackets, but there have also been some that happen to be blue-black in shade. They Construct their nests in mud.

Although bees and wasps share comparable shades, They're pretty diverse species of insect. One way to tell apart between The 2 are with their system form. Bees are generally slightly plumper and hairier, although wasps are slender and smooth.

Wasps can help during the management of other pests, specially in read more agriculture as biological control agents. Lots of wasps also feed on nectar from flowers and for that reason perform as pollinators.
Wasps don’t lose their stinger and can continuously assault when threatened. Quite a few styles are hugely aggressive and will act with each other to protect threats to their nest.
